On July 21, Springis Entertainment, a company affiliated with the boy band Seventeen, said through SNS that fu Shengkuan, a member of the group Seventeen, had torn his left ankle ligament, and the combination activity was temporarily carried out in the form of a 12-person group.

According to the affiliated agency, during the recent dance practice, Fu Shengkuan accidentally injured his ankle and was diagnosed with a torn ligament in his left ankle after a precise examination and diagnosis at the hospital.

The injured part was operated on saturday under the guidance of a professional doctor.

Now that Fu Shengkuan is stabilizing and recovering after the operation, he needs a temporary rest to focus on state management and recovery, so he will temporarily suspend his activities from today. The combined Semen plan will temporarily carry out a 12-person group activity.

It is reported that this is not the first time that Fu Shengkuan's ankle ligament has been torn. In May 2017, during the release of the album "Don't Want to Cry" and the release of the single album "HIT" in August 2019, the group also suffered an ankle injury.
